SkyWest Airlines Flight Makes Emergency Landing in Chicago

SkyWest Airlines flight OO-3079 had to return and make an emergency landing in Chicago, Illinois, on February 18th.

The plane took off for Salt Lake City, Utah, but had to return shortly afterwards after the crew failed to retract landing gear. The plane landed back safely.

All passengers and crew members remained unharmed.

The airline arranged a replacement plane for the passengers.

Maldivian Airlines Plane Suffers Tail Strike While Landing in Maldives

A Maldivian Airlines plane struck its tail onto runway while landing in Kooddoo Island, Maldives, on February 18th.

The incident happened when the plane was performing flight Q2-160 from Kadhdhoo, Maldives.

The plane taxied to apron without further incident.

No injuries were reported.

Small Plane Crashed in Bayonne, New Jersey; Pilot Injured

A Piper PA-28 plane crashed in a residential area in Bayonne, New Jersey, on February 19th.

The plane went down on Avenue E between 41st and 42nd streets, knocking out some power lines.

The pilot, who was the only one aboard, was injured and was taken to Saint Barnabas Medical Center, New Jersey.

The cause of accident is being investigated.

Indian Air Force Helicopter Makes Emergency Landing due to Technical Snag

An Indian Air Force helicopter had to make an emergency landing in a field in Bengaluru, Karnataka, India, on February 19th.

The MI 8 helicopter was heading from Yelahanka Air Force Station, Bengaluru, Karnataka to Sulur Air Force Station, Coimbatore, Tamil Nadu, when the pilot decided to land in emergency due to a technical snag.

The chopper landed safely in a field near Koppa Gate of Bannerghatta, Bengaluru.

There were 6 people aboard at the time; all of them remained unharmed.
